Data Strategies in AI: The VAST Data Revolution

Subramanian Kartik1

Vice President of Systems Engineering, VAST Data

Modern workloads driving innovation in every sector are pushing the frontier of AI with state-of-the-art techniques in Machine and Deep Learning at scale. Groundbreaking techniques in Computer Vision, Natural Language Processing and large scale Structured Data Analytics are just a few examples of transformative architectures in high-end computing.  The high-performance IO necessary for time to value, characterized by heavy random read patterns, lends itself naturally to solid state storage systems. With namespaces in the 10’s to 100’s of PBs, users no longer need to compromise on performance, scale or ease of management – all with low All-Flash cost. Subramanian Kartik has been the Vice President of Systems Engineering at VAST Data since January of 2020, running the global presales organization. He is part of the incredible success of VAST Data which increased almost 10-fold in valuation and revenue in this period. An accomplished technologist and executive in the industry, he has a wide array of experience in Cloud Architectures, AI/Machine Learning/Deep Learning, as well as in the  Life Sciences, covering high-performance computing and storage. He has had a lifelong deep passion for studying complex problems in all spheres spanning both workloads and infrastructure at the vanguard of current day technology.

Prior to his work at VAST Data, he was with EMC (later Dell) for two decades, as both a Distinguished Engineer and global executive running the Converged and Hyperconverged Division  go-to-market. He has a Ph.D in Particle Physics with over 75 publications and 3 patents to his credit over the years.
